Patterning Polyelectrolyte Complexes with Alternating Monomer Sequence Distributions
semanticscholar(2019)
Abstract
Charge-driven complexation of polyelectrolytes in water is a fundamental phase separation
phenomenon that is prevalent in nature and across the high-value technology landscape. Here we describe an experimentally
convenient and versatile approach to construct patterned PECs, comprising well-defined charged
macromolecules with both ionic styrene and neutral maleimide units alternating in the chain
sequence.
